
Krystian Bielik to Arsenal: Latest Transfer Details, Reaction and More
Arsenal officially announced the capture of 17-year-old midfielder Krystian Bielik from Legia Warsaw on Wednesday, bringing an end to a transfer saga that had the talented youngster seemingly on the brink of a move for weeks.

The talented Poland youth international only joined Legia last season but quickly established himself as one of the best up-and-coming players in the country, and a series of impressive performances caught the eye of Gunners manager Arsene Wenger.
In dire need of a holding midfielder, Arsenal have been linked with a move for Bielik for weeks. A transfer always seemed likely, and on Thursday, Jan. 15, reports started to leak the two clubs had come to an agreement.

Bielik commented via Legia's official website: "I'm going to London to fulfill my dreams. I hope I will become an Arsenal player soon."
He is expected to join Arsenal's senior squad upon completion of the transfer, but while the young midfielder has tremendous potential and should be an excellent signing with an eye on the future, he likely won't be playing significant minutes anytime soon.

Regardless, Bielik will likely be given all the time in the world to adapt to the Premier League's pace and physicality, and it would be a major shock if he sees consistent playing time before his 19th birthday.
The teenager has the talent to be an excellent contributor at some point down the road, and for a minimal investment, the Gunners have bagged themselves a youngster who could be the answer to one of the club's biggest needs in just a couple of seasons.
